Lawrence Bishnoi brought to Mohali for voice sample

Tribune News Service

Mohali, July 21

Gangster Lawrence Bishnoi was brought by the Punjab Police to the Cyber Crime Cell in Phase IV, Mohali, today for taking his voice samples.

Bishnoi, who is the main conspirator behind the murder of popular Punjabi singer Sidhu Moosewala, remained in the cyber cell for more than an hour. Punjab Police commandos were deployed at the Phase V market opposite the cell.

Police sources said the voice sample of the gangster had been taken so that it could be matched with the recording of phone calls made by him to people in the past, including gangster Goldy Brar in Canada. The police also keep samples of the voices of gangsters so that even if they change their disguise, they can be identified with their voice.

Muktsar cops get custody

Muktsar: The district police today brought gangster Lawrence Bishnoi on a transit remand from Hoshiarpur and produced him in a Malout court in connection with the murder of Ranjit Singh, alias Rana Sidhu, a financier. The court sent him to seven-day police custody.

Rana was shot dead by four armed attackers at Aulakh village on the Muktsar-Malout highway on October 22, 2020.

Balkar Singh, DSP, Malout, said: “The court has sent Lawrence Bishnoi on seven-day police remand and will be produced in the court on July 28.”
